General Objective:

To manage, execute, and deliver projects successfully in accordance with the highest standards of quality and professionalism. The Project Manager is responsible for adhering to approved methodologies while maintaining a sharp focus on client needs to ensure all project strategic goals are met.

Years of Experience:

8 to 11 years of proven experience in managing and executing projects similar in nature to the company's scope and target clientele.

Key Roles & Responsibilities:

Project Lifecycle Management: Plan, execute, and monitor all project phases, including budget allocation, scheduling, and resource management.

Quality Assurance & Delivery: Ensure all project deliverables meet the defined specifications, requirements, and quality standards.

Change Management: Analyze change requests and take necessary actions to mitigate risks or adjust project scopes.

Performance Monitoring: Track project progress using Key Performance Indicators (KPIs), schedule variance, and completion rates. Provide periodic reports on project status and financial performance.

Logistical Support: Provide and manage all support services necessary for efficient project execution, including procurement, recruitment, and monitoring man-hours.

Problem Solving & Escalation: Address technical and administrative obstacles promptly; escalate critical issues to senior management when necessary.

Stakeholder Management: Maintain continuous communication with clients and partners to ensure satisfaction and alignment.

RFP & Proposal Contribution: Assist in developing technical and financial proposals for external projects and tenders (RFPs).

Presentation & Reporting: Prepare high-level presentations and progress reports for executive management and stakeholders.

Project Documentation: Manage all project-related documentation, archive records, and document Lessons Learned as company organizational assets.

Professional Certifications & Skills:

PMP Certified (Project Management Professional).

Financial & Schedule Proficiency: Deep understanding of Earned Value Management (EVM), specifically CPI (Cost Performance Index) and SPI (Schedule Performance Index).

Software Mastery: Expert-level proficiency in Microsoft Project (MS Project) and other PM tools.
